Right now I admin 100+ Linux machines, along with four or five
colleagues, of those I know the root password to maybe 10.

sudo in that situation makes a lot of sense. For the home user
I think the choice is mostly a matter of preference. There are
pros and cons of both mandating root, or using sudo extensively.
